Sikhs protesting against Mulund firing

Following the shocking incident, around 500 Sikh protesters blocked the National Highway-10 in Sirsa, (hometown of Ram Rahim), Haryana. The protestors were demanding action against those responsible for firing on Sikhs in Mumbai on late Friday.

A 50 years old Sikh was killed in firing by the body guard of Dera Saccha Sauda chief Ram Rahim on Friday outside a suburban mall in Mumbai during a protest against the spiritual guru by a Sikh group which turned violent. A group of Sikhs shouted anti-Dera slogans inside the Nirmal Lifestyles mall in suburban Mulund during a visit by Ram Rahim to the place this evening.

The victim, who was killed in the firing, was identified as Balkar Singh, while two passers-by suffered injuries. The Sikh community in Mumbai has announced that they will not cremate Balkar Singh, unless the “Baba” is arrested.
